The Samsung Galaxy S24 FE, released in late 2024, and the Motorola Moto G 2022, launched in mid-2022, represent distinct approaches to smartphone design and functionality. While both devices operate on the Android platform, the Galaxy S24 FE offers a more premium experience with advanced display technology and camera capabilities, whereas the Moto G 2022 focuses on extended battery life and essential features. These differences cater to varying user priorities, from those seeking cutting-edge performance to those valuing endurance and straightforward operation.

The Samsung Galaxy S24 FE and the Motorola Moto G 2022 cater to different segments of the smartphone market, each with distinct strengths and trade-offs. User feedback for the Galaxy S24 FE often praises its vibrant display, robust performance for everyday tasks and gaming, and the long-term software support provided by Samsung. Common criticisms sometimes point to its camera performance in low light and charging speeds not being as fast as some competitors.
Conversely, the Motorola Moto G 2022 is frequently lauded for its exceptional battery life, often lasting up to two days on a single charge, and the inclusion of a headphone jack. However, users often note its less vibrant display, modest camera performance, and slower charging as areas where it falls short compared to higher-end devices.
Users prioritizing a premium display, strong processing power for demanding applications, advanced camera features, and extensive software longevity will find the Galaxy S24 FE well-suited to their needs. Its robust build and long-term update commitment make it a compelling choice for those seeking a device that remains current for many years. For individuals who value extended battery life above all else, along with a more straightforward user experience and the convenience of a headphone jack, the Motorola Moto G 2022 presents a practical option. It is a reliable device for essential smartphone functions and prolonged usage between charges.
